Delhi Metro connects Sultanpur and Shalimar Bagh with 3 route options, covering approximately 31.7 km. A token fare is ₹54, while smart card users pay ₹49. Trains run from 6:10 AM to 11:17 PM, about every 4–6 minutes.
Via Dilli Haat INA: 1 Interchange · 1 Hour 5 Minutes · ₹54
Via Rajiv Chowk and Rajouri Garden: 2 Interchanges · 1 Hour 24 Minutes · ₹64
Via Hauz Khas, Janakpuri West and Rajouri Garden: 3 Interchanges · 1 Hour 27 Minutes · ₹64

3 routes are available from Sultanpur to Shalimar Bagh on Delhi Metro:
via Yellow Line and Pink Circular Line
via Yellow Line and Blue Main Line (Dwarka - Noida) and Pink Circular Line
via Yellow Line and Magenta Line (Krishna Park Extension - Botanical Garden) and Blue Main Line (Dwarka - Noida) and Pink Circular Line
Trains run daily from 6:10 AM to 11:17 PM, every 4–6 minutes.
Steps below describe the Via Dilli Haat INA route (1 interchange, 1 Hour 5 Minutes). For other options, see the Route Overview tabs above.
Sultanpur, Chhatarpur, Qutab Minar, Saket, Malviya Nagar, Hauz Khas, Green Park, AIIMS, Dilli Haat INA, Sarojini Nagar, Bhikaji Cama Place, Sir M. Vishweshwaraiah Moti Bagh, Durgabai Deshmukh South Campus, Delhi Cantt, Naraina Vihar, Mayapuri, Rajouri Garden, ESI Basaidarapur, Punjabi Bagh West, Shakurpur, Netaji Subhash Place, Shalimar Bagh
